基于单节动力锂电池的太阳能智能小车驱动电源
资料介绍
针对以太阳能作为动力来源的智能小车,提出了新的驱动电源解决方案。方案中的储能部分仅使用单节动力锂电池,Boost电路将锂电池的输出电压升压,作为电机的驱动电源。太阳能充电管理电路基于上海如韵电子的CN3791芯片,具有最大功率点跟踪功能。Boost电路基于TI的TPS61088,将锂电池的3.7V输出电压升至9V,负载电流可达3A,并且转换效率高达91%。经过实际测试,方案可满足智能小车的功率需求。
A new drive power supply solution is proposed for the smart vehicle using solar energy as power source.In this solution,a single Power Li-Po is used as energy storage unit which output is boosted to drive motor.Solar charging management circuit is based on CN3791 which is featured by maximun power point tracing.The 3.7V output voltage of LiPo is boosted to 9V by TI TPS61088,which conversion efficiency can reached 91% and current is up to 3A.
